Rio Lagartos
Location
:
Mexico
|
Rio Lagartos is a small, quiet town perched on a tiny peninsula at the entrance to the inlet of ocean water, also called Rio Lagartos, or La Ria. Located on the northern shore of the eastern Yucatan, this charming town has streets that point every which way, and tend to change names frequently. To get your bearings, Calle 10 is the main street of town, and runs to the waterfront. Rio Lagartos major attraction is the multitude of flamingos, one of the largest concentrations in the Western Hemisphere, that live in nearby Rio Lagartos National Park. Merida
Location
:
Mexico
|
Meridas lineage dates back to January of 1542 during the Spanish explorations of Mexico. Spanish nobleman Don Francisco de Montejo founded the city on the site of the ancient Maya city of T'Ho. The new city's buildings were constructed using stones expropriated from the Mayan ruins.
Today, Merida is a city of wide tree-lined boulevards and historic stately mansions. While quaint it is still a bustling capital of the State of Yucatan and its largest city. It has been known as the Paris of the West because of the many products once imported from France by Meridas wealthy citizens. Cancun
Location
:
Mexico
|
The city is actually split in two main area, the Zona Hotelera, which is a an 18 Km long island which is located facing the caribbean on one side along a long sunny beach strip with many large fancy hotels and on the other back side it is surrounded by a beautiful lagoon called Laguna Nichupte. The second part of the city is called Ciudad Cancun, which is in the mainland. This is where most of the Cancun local people live, and also where tourists can find more budget accommodations. Ciudad Cancun and Zona Hotelera are joined by this long causeway/bridge. They are literally two different worlds. Chiapas
Location
:
Mexico
|
Chiapas has one of the largest and most diverse indigenous populations with approximately 959,066 indigenous language speakers over the age of five, or 27% of the states population. It is home to nine major ethnicities and was a center of Mayan Empire with ceremonial city centers in Palenque and Yaxchiln. However, it is second only to Oaxaca in both indigenous population size and that populations marginality in terms of socio-economic development. Ironically, Chiapas is also one of the states with the most diverse resource base, and the generator of 35% of Mexicos electricity through hydropower. Copper Canyon
Location
:
Mexico
|
Copper Canyon is located in the North of Mexico. It is not one single Canyon but rather a series of more than 20 canyons running through the northern region of Mexico. The canyon covers over 20,000 square miles and is four times larger than the Grand Canyon in the U.S.

Baja California
Location
:
Mexico
|
Baja California is that 1300 kilometer long arm that dangles down from the US border between the Pacific and the Gulf of California. The whole of the peninsula consists of rugged and nearly uninhabited mountains.
Baja California is the twelfth state by area in Mexico. Its geography ranks from beaches to forests and deserts. The backbone of the state is the Sierra de Baja California; where the Picacho Del Diablo, the highest point of the peninsula, is located. This mountain range effectively divides the weather patterns in the state.

Capacuaro
Location
:
Mexico
|
On Highway 37 midway between Uruapan and Paracho is the small village of Capacuaro. Capacuaro is known for their carved furniture. The men of the village are mostly carpenters creating chairs, tables, dressers, and many other pieces of hand-carved furniture in Mexican colonial style.
==== CEPACUARO - LOCATION
Located in the center of the Meseta Purepecha region of Michoacan.
==== CEPACUARO - ATTRACTION
The village is home to a 16th century Parish Church with a facade that features cherubs, flowers, and shells carved in the stone.

Cuernavaca
Location
:
Mexico
|
Cuernavaca is the capital and largest city of the state of Morelos in Mexico. Cuernavaca is called the City of Eternal Spring for its perfect weather and abundant flora and fauna. Cuernavaca is a modern city yet it retains much of Mexico's original culture and amazing architecture.
==== CUERNAVACA - SIGHTSEEING
You can visit many museums and historical landmarks in and around the city, and you can use it as a travel base for your adventures in Tepoztlan or Taxco. Be sure to visit the Borda Gardens, the Cathedral, and the Chapel of San Jose, which is the oldest and largest in all of Mexico and Latin America. You should also visit the pyramid of Teopanzolco to the north.
